Missioned Souls go for a drive
This cover of Highway Star was done by a band of siblings from the Philippines, who apparently have become a minor YouTube sensation with a following of reactions, no less. The band is called Missioned Souls and includes ICE (age 11) on the drums, Stacey (12) on rhythm guitar and lead vocals, Neisha (14) on lead guitars, Naces (16) on bass and keyboards, with the whole affair produced and engineered by their dad Secan.
